Git是一种分布式版本控制系统,它可以帮助开发人员更好地管理代码。Git的使用方法包括:初始化配置Git仓库,设置个人信息和默认编辑器;提交信息要简洁明了,使用有意义的标题和描述;分支管理中,为新功能或修复创建分支,定期合并并保持主分支稳定;进行代码审查以保证质量 。
本文目录导读:
在软件开发过程中,版本控制是一种非常重要的技术手段,它可以帮助团队成员更好地协同工作,追踪代码的变更历史,以及在出现问题时进行回滚,Git是目前最流行的版本控制系统之一,它的设计理念和操作方式与其他系统有很大的不同,本文将对GIT版本控制进行详细解读,并通过实际案例演示如何使用GIT进行项目开发和管理。
GIT简介
Git是一个分布式版本控制系统,用于跟踪文件或目录的更改,它采用了一种名为“快照”的方式来记录文件的状态,这使得GIT可以在不损失数据完整性的情况下高效地处理大量数据,GIT的核心功能包括提交(commit)、分支(branch)和合并(merge)等操作。
GIT安装与配置
1、安装Git:访问Git官网(https://git-scm.com/)下载对应操作系统的安装包,按照提示进行安装即可。
2、配置用户名和邮箱:在命令行中输入以下命令,将用户名和邮箱替换为你自己的信息。
git config --global user.name "你的用户名" git config --global user.email "你的邮箱"
GIT基本操作
1、初始化仓库:在项目根目录下执行以下命令,创建一个新的Git仓库。
git init
2、添加文件到暂存区:使用以下命令将文件添加到暂存区。
git add 文件名
3、提交更改:使用以下命令将暂存区的文件提交到本地仓库。
git commit -m "提交信息"
4、查看状态:使用以下命令查看当前仓库的状态。
git status
5、查看提交历史:使用以下命令查看最近的几次提交记录。
git log
6、创建分支:使用以下命令创建一个新的分支。
git branch 分支名
7、切换分支:使用以下命令切换到指定分支。
git checkout 分支名
8、合并分支:使用以下命令将指定分支的更改合并到当前分支。
git merge 分支名
四、实战案例:使用GIT进行项目管理与协作开发
1、多人协作开发:在一个团队中,每个人都可以在自己的分支上进行开发,然后定期将更改推送到远程仓库,当需要合并其他人的更改时,可以使用git pull
命令拉取远程仓库的最新更改,然后使用git merge
命令将这些更改合并到本地分支,这样可以确保团队成员之间的工作是同步进行的。
2、解决冲突:在多人协作开发过程中,可能会出现多个开发者同时修改了同一份文件的情况,这时需要手动解决冲突,将冲突部分标记出来,然后由团队成员协商解决,解决冲突后,使用git add
和git commit
命令将更改提交到本地仓库,使用git push
命令将本地仓库的更改推送到远程仓库。